Features of the battery modules

19 “ drawer-type chassis with 3 HU, 4 HU and 2x4 HU

Rated voltage 24 V

Energy storage
completely maintenance-free, universal-location lead batteries with grid plates and fixed electrolyte,
suitable for cycle operation, continuous battery power supply and trickle charge.

Exhaustive discharge protection relay controlled by DEM 313 charger

Charging input and battery outputs via AMP flat pin terminals 6.3 x 0.8 mm
charging input and all battery outputs fused.

Temperature tracking of charging voltage at standby charge depending on the battery temperature
with integrated temperature sensor.

Batteries with VdS-registration and UL recognition.

The technical specifications comply with the requirements issued by the “Leistungsgemeinschaft
Beschallungstechnik”, pertaining to the professional association for audio and video technology in
the ZVEI.
